Abstract

Disclosed is a nonaqueous electrolyte secondary battery which has a negative electrode containing silicon as a negative active material, a positive electrode containing a positive active material, a nonaqueous electrolyte and a separator. Characteristically, an additive which retards oxidation of silicon during operation of the battery is contained either in an interior or surface portion of the positive electrode, or in an interior or surface portion of the negative electrode, or in an interior or surface portion of the separator.

Claims (13)

1. A nonaqueous electrolyte secondary battery which includes a negative electrode containing silicon as a negative active material, a positive electrode containing a positive active material, a nonaqueous electrolyte and a separator;

said battery being characterized in that, as an additive which retards oxidation of said silicon during battery operation, succinic anhydride is contained either in an interior or surface portion of said positive electrode, or in an interior or surface portion of said negative electrode, or in an interior or surface portion of said separator, and said nonaqueous electrolyte contains a film former which forms a film on a surface of said negative electrode, said film former comprising vinylene carbonate.

2. The nonaqueous electrolyte secondary battery as recited in claim 1 , characterized in that said succinic anhydride is contained in said interior or surface portion of the positive electrode.

3. The nonaqueous electrolyte secondary battery as recited in claim 1 , characterized in that said succinic anhydride is contained in said interior or surface portion of the negative electrode and a film former which forms a film on a surface of the negative electrode is contained in said nonaqueous electrolyte.

4. The nonaqueous electrolyte secondary battery as recited in claim 1 , characterized in that said succinic anhydride is contained in said interior or surface portion of the separator.

5. The nonaqueous electrolyte secondary battery as recited in claim 1 , characterized in that said negative electrode is an electrode fabricated by depositing a thin film of silicon or silicon ally on a current collector.

6. The nonaqueous electrolyte secondary battery as recited in claim 5 , characterized in that said thin film has such a columnar structure that it is divided into columns by gaps formed therein and extending in its thickness direction.

7. The nonaqueous electrolyte secondary battery as recited in claim 1 , characterized in that said negative active material comprises an alloy of silicon and other metal.

8. The nonaqueous electrolyte secondary battery as recited in claim 1 , characterized in that said succinic anhydride in the nonaqueous electrolyte exists in the solid form.

9. The nonaqueous electrolyte secondary battery as recited in claim 1 , characterized in that said succinic anhydride has a mean particle size within a particle size distribution of said positive or negative active material.

10. The nonaqueous electrolyte secondary battery as recited in claim 1 , characterized in that said succinic anhydride is held within a support material.

11. The nonaqueous electrolyte secondary battery as recited in claim 10 , characterized in that said support material comprises solid fine particles (fillers).

12. The nonaqueous electrolyte secondary battery as recited in claim 10 , characterized in that said support material is electronically conductive.
